在数控928系统中使用G71进行编程,主要涉及到外圆粗车循环的指令格式。G71指令用于执行轴向粗车循环,其格式如下:
```plaintext
G71 U_ R_; G71 P_ Q_ U_ W_ F_; N10 N20...
```
其中:
`G71`:表示开始外圆粗车循环。
`U_`:表示X轴的精加工轮廓起点的坐标值。
`R_`:表示X轴方向每次进刀量,直径值表示,无符号数。
`P_`:表示循环开始段。
`Q_`:表示循环结束段。
`U_`:表示X轴精车余量。
`W_`:表示Z轴精车余量。
`F_`:表示切削速度。
`N10 N20...`:表示循环执行的次数或条件。
具体的编程步骤如下:
1. 确定外圆粗车循环的起始点坐标(X轴),并记录为`U_`的值。
2. 确定每次X轴方向的进刀量(直径值),并记录为`R_`的值。
3. 确定循环的起始段(`P_`)和结束段(`Q_`)。
4. 确定X轴和Z轴的精车余量(`U_`和`W_`),如果不留余量则不写。
5. 确定切削速度`F_`。
6. 编写循环执行的次数或条件(`N10 N20...`)。
例如,以下是一个简单的G71编程实例:
```plaintext
G71 U35.1 I5 K2 L6 F300
```
其中:
`U35.1`:表示第一刀起刀点的位置。
`I5`:表示X轴直径的切削量。
`K2`:表示退刀量。
`L6`:表示循环次数。
`F300`:表示切削速度。
请注意,不同版本的数控系统可能对G71指令的支持有所不同,建议参考具体系统的编程手册以确保正确使用。